< 歴代誌Ⅱ 13 >

1 ヤラベアム王の十八年にアビヤ、ユダの王となり
In the eighteenth year of King Jeroboam, Abijah became king over Judah.
2 ヱルサレムにて三年の間世を治めたり其母はギベアのウリエルの女にして名をミカヤといふ茲にアビヤとヤラベアムの間に戰爭あり
He was king in Jerusalem for three years; his mother's name was Maacah, the daughter of Uriel of Gibeah. And there was war between Abijah and Jeroboam.
3 アビヤは四十萬の軍勢をもて戰闘に備ふ是みな倔強の猛き武夫なり又ヤラベアムは倔強の人八十萬をもて之にむかひて戰爭の行伍を立つ是また大勇士なり
And Abijah went out to the fight with an army of men of war, four hundred thousand of his best men; and Jeroboam put his forces in line against him, eight hundred thousand of his best men of war.
4 時にアビヤ、エフライムの山地なるゼマライム山の上に立て言けるはヤラベアムおよびイスラエルの人々皆聽よ
And Abijah took up his position on Mount Zemaraim, in the hill-country of Ephraim, and said, Give ear to me, O Jeroboam and all Israel:
5 汝ら知ずやイスラエルの神ヱホバ鹽の契約をもてイスラエルの國を永くダビデとその子孫に賜へり
Is it not clear to you that the Lord, the God of Israel, gave the rule over Israel to David and to his sons for ever, by an agreement made with salt?
6 然るにダビデの子ソロモンの臣たるネバテの子ヤラベアム興りてその主君に叛き
But Jeroboam, the son of Nebat, the servant of Solomon, the son of David, took up arms against his lord.
7 邪曲なる放蕩者これに集り附き自ら強くしてソロモンの子レハベアムに敵せしがレハベアムは少くまた心弱くして之に當る力なかりき
And certain foolish and good-for-nothing men were joined with him, and made themselves strong against Rehoboam, the son of Solomon, when he was young and untested and not able to keep them back.
8 今またなんぢらはダビデの子孫の手にあるヱホバの國に敵對せんとす汝らは大軍なり又ヤラベアムが作りて汝らの神と爲たる金の犢なんぢらと偕にあり
And now it is your purpose to put yourselves against the authority which the Lord has put into the hands of the sons of David, and you are a very great number, and you have with you the gold oxen which Jeroboam made to be your gods.
9 汝らはアロンの子孫たるヱホバの祭司とレビ人とを逐放ち國々の民の爲がごとくに祭司を立るにあらずや即ち誰にもあれ少き牡牛一匹牡羊七匹を携へきたりて手に充す者は皆かの神ならぬ者の祭司となることを得るなり
And after driving out the priests of the Lord, the sons of Aaron and the Levites, have you not made priests for yourselves as the people of other lands do? so that anyone who comes to make himself priest by offering an ox or seven sheep, may be a priest of those who are no gods.
10 然ど我儕に於てはヱホバ我儕の神にましまして我儕は之を棄ずまたヱホバに事ふる祭司はアロンの子孫にして役事をなす者はレビ人なり
But as for us, the Lord is our God, and we have not been turned away from him; we have priests who do the work of the Lord, even the sons of Aaron and the Levites in their places;
11 彼ら朝ごと夕ごとにヱホバに燔祭を献げ香を焚くことを爲し又供前のパンを純精の案の上に供へまた金の燈臺とその燈盞を整へて夕ごとに點すなり斯われらは我らの神ヱホバの職守を守れども汝らは却て彼を棄たり
By whom burned offerings and perfumes are sent up in smoke before the Lord every morning and every evening; and they put out the holy bread on its table and the gold support for the lights with its lights burning every evening; for we keep the orders given to us by the Lord our God, but you have gone away from him.
12 視よ神みづから我らとともに在して我らの大將となりたまふまた其祭司等は喇叭を吹ならして汝らを攻むイスラエルの子孫よ汝らの先祖の神ヱホバに敵して戰ふ勿れ汝ら利あらざるべければなりと
And now God is with us at our head, and his priests with their loud horns sounding against you. O children of Israel, do not make war on the Lord, the God of your fathers, for it will not go well for you.
13 ヤラベアム伏兵を彼らの後に回らせたればイスラエルはユダの前にあり伏兵は其後にあり
But Jeroboam had put some of his men to make a surprise attack on them from the back, so some were facing Judah and others were stationed secretly at their back.
14 ユダ後を顧みるに敵前後にありければヱホバにむかひて號呼り祭司等喇叭を吹り
And Judah, turning their faces, saw that they were being attacked in front and at the back; and they gave a cry for help to the Lord, while the priests were sounding their horns.
15 ユダの人々すなはち吶喊を擧けるがユダの人々吶喊を擧るにあたりて神ヤラベアムとイスラエルの人々をアビヤとユダの前に打敗り給ひしかば
And the men of Judah gave a loud cry; and at their cry, God put fear into Jeroboam and all Israel before Abijah and Judah.
16 イスラエルの子孫はユダの前より逃はしれり神かく彼らを之が手に付したまひければ
And the children of Israel went in flight before Judah, and God gave them up into their hands.
17 アビヤとその民彼らを夥多く撃殺せりイスラエルの殺されて倒れし者は五十萬人みな倔強の人なりき
And Abijah and his people put them to death with great destruction: five hundred thousand of the best of Israel were put to the sword.
18 是時にはイスラエルの子孫打負されユダの子孫勝を得たり是は彼らその先祖の神ヱホバを賴みしが故なり
So at that time the children of Israel were overcome, and the children of Judah got the better of them, because they put their faith in the Lord, the God of their fathers.
19 アビヤすなはちヤラベアムを追撃て邑數箇を彼より取れり即ちベテルとその郷里ヱシヤナとその郷里エフロンとその郷里是なり
And Abijah went after Jeroboam and took some of his towns, Beth-el with its small towns and Jeshanah with its small towns and Ephron with its small towns.
20 ヤラベアムはアビヤの世に再び權勢を奮ふことを得ずヱホバに撃れて死り
And Jeroboam did not get back his power again in the life-time of Abijah; and the Lord sent death on him.
21 然どアビヤは權勢を得妻十四人を娶り男子二十二人女子十六人を擧けたり
But Abijah became great, and had fourteen wives, and became the father of twenty-two sons and sixteen daughters.
22 アビヤのその餘の作爲とその行爲とその言は預言者イドの註釋に記さる
And the rest of the acts of Abijah, and his ways and his sayings, are recorded in the account of the prophet Iddo.
